Basketball Pistons Push Rebuild Button

The Detroit Pistons have pushed the rebuild button. After losing Blake Griffin to a season-ending injury, the Pistons traded franchise center Andre Drummond to the Cleveland Cavaliers before the All-Star break. Then in the recent days, they bought out starters Markieff Morris and Reggie Jackson.

The Pistons are coming off a loss to the Portland Trail Blazers on Sunday night. Detroit’s bench scored a total of 70 points and was led by reserve big man Christian Wood who put up 26 points and 9 rebounds. Derrick Rose was the only starter in double digits as he scored 15 points. Brandon Knight and Langston Galloway put up double-digit scoring off the Pistons’ bench.

Detroit ranks 24th in the league in scoring at 107.9 points per game. They are 15th in passing at 24.0 assists per game and have the 4th worst rebounding average overall at 42.5 boards pulled down per contest. The Pistons are 17th in scoring defense at 110.8 points per game allowed this season.

Basketball Denver Is Healthy

After surviving a mid-season filled with injuries to its starters, the Denver Nuggets are healthy again. Except for rookie big man Bol Bol, head coach Mike Malone has every weapon on his roster at his disposal. The Nuggets have won seven out of their last 10 games played and they have the 2nd best record in the Western Conference behind the Los Angeles Lakers.

Nikola Jokic is averaging 27.3 points per game in February while Jamal Murray is putting up 26.4 during the same period. Paul Millsap, who missed 16 games due to injury, is coming off a game where he scored a season-high 25 points. With everyone healthy, Denver’s main problem right now is a good one and that is distributing minutes to every player.

The Nuggets have the 5th best scoring defense in the league at 106.9 points per game allowed. They are pulling down 44.6 rebounds per game and issuing an average of 26,4 assists per contest, 4th best in the league. Denver is ranked 18th in scoring at 110.6 points per game scored per game.
